Google Ambassadors Google launched the second cycle of the Google Ambassadors program in universities in Egypt today as part of its commitment to improving the capabilities of the academic community in the Middle East and North Africa. Through this program, Google invites students studying at universities from all over the Middle East and North Africa to represent Google at their universities and perform the roles assigned to them during one academic year. This program aims to provide basic information, background, and tools to help develop future leaders in the Middle East and North Africa region.
700 students applied to join Google's second university ambassador program, from which Google selected 234 ambassadors, representing 70 universities from across the region. Google Ambassadors Wael El-Fakharany, Regional Director of Google in Egypt and North Africa, speaks to the new Ambassadors at the opening of the second session of the Google Ambassadors Program in Universities. The training course aims to provide the necessary understanding and skills to students in order to enhance their experience at the university.
University Ambassadors will also work alongside Google teams to organize events and help spread awareness among students in the MENA region about the opportunities and value that Google and the Internet offer. The events carried out by Google Ambassadors at universities last year were able to communicate with more than 350,000 students from all over the region, and many of them received valuable scholarships and training around the world.
